Data Scientist

The data scientist analyzes and models large datasets using advanced tools such as machine learning to extract actionable insights and guide strategic decisions.

Data Analyst

The data analyst converts raw data into clear, actionable reports using visualization and statistical analysis tools, often collaborating with data science teams.

AI/Machine Learning Developer

The AI / Machine Learning developer designs and implements predictive models and machine learning algorithms to solve complex data-related problems.

Data Director / Chief Data Officer (CDO)

The Chief Data Officer oversees data management and analysis strategies, leveraging data science approaches to maximize the value of data within the company.
